Key Insights from the Survey
The survey collected data from diverse demographics, concentrating on factors such as space efficiency, shared living, and sustainability's role in modern housing. Below are some of the most striking insights gathered:
A significant portion of participants preferred open-concept designs, which foster a sense of freedom and spaciousness, particularly in confined areas.
Numerous respondents indicated a desire for versatile furniture solutions that optimize space while maintaining a stylish appearance and comfort level.
A clear inclination towards sustainable living emerged, with many respondents expressing a preference for eco-conscious materials and energy-saving designs in their homes.
Urban respondents highlighted obstacles such as inadequate storage options and noise disturbances, emphasizing the need for creative storage solutions and effective soundproofing strategies.
